15 nützliche Tastenkombinationen für Visual Studio Code zur Steigerung der Produktivität

Es besteht kein Zweifel, dass Microsofts VS Code einer der besten Open-Source-Code-Editoren auf dem Markt ist. Im Gegensatz zum legendären Vim muss man bei VS Code kein Tastatur-Ninja sein und hat jede Menge Funktionen, auf die Entwickler schwören.

Dies bedeutet jedoch nicht, dass Sie keine Tastenkombinationen in Visual Studio Code verwenden können oder sollten.

Hassen Sie es, Ihren Codierungsfluss zu unterbrechen und Ihre Hand zu einer Maus zu bewegen, um eine Aktion wie das Umschalten des Terminals in Ihrem Visual Studio Code (VS Code)-Editor auszuführen? Wenn ja, sollten Sie sich sofort vertraut machen und diese nützlichen Tastenkombinationen für VS Code auswendig lernen.

Es hilft Ihnen nicht nur, eine Maus loszuwerden, sondern macht Sie auch hochproduktiv und effizient.

Lassen Sie uns also lernen, wie Sie schnell codieren können, indem Sie mithilfe von Tastenkombinationen schnell durch den Code-Editor navigieren.

Nützliche VS Code-Tastaturkürzel

Nur ein Haftungsausschluss. Diese Tastenkombinationen finde ich am nützlichsten, wenn ich in VS Code arbeite. Sie können je nach Bedarf weitere davon erkunden.

Ich habe auch Tastaturkürzel für macOS-Benutzer erwähnt.

1. Alle Befehle anzeigen

Windows/LinuxMac OS
STRG + UMSCHALT + P oder F1SHIFT + ⌘ + P oder F1

Beginnend mit der hilfreichsten Verknüpfung öffnet es die Befehlspalette, die Zugriff auf alle Funktionen von VS Code bietet.

Befehlspalette

Es ist eine sehr wichtige VS-Code-Verknüpfung, denn selbst wenn Sie eine Verknüpfung außer dieser vergessen oder sich nicht merken möchten, können Sie mit der Befehlspalette verschiedene Operationen ausführen, z. B. eine neue Datei erstellen, Einstellungen öffnen, Design ändern und alles anzeigen auch Tastenkombinationen.

2. VS-Code-Editor vertikal oder horizontal aufteilen

Windows/LinuxMac OS
STRG ++

Wenn Sie kein Multi-Monitor-Setup für hohe Produktivität haben, können Sie dennoch Codes mehrerer Dateien gleichzeitig anzeigen, indem Sie den Editor entweder horizontal oder vertikal aufteilen.

VS-Code teilen

Um den Fokus in die Editorgruppe zu ändern, können Sie entweder die Zahlen- oder die Pfeiltasten verwenden.

Windows/LinuxMac OS
STRG + 1/2/3+ 1/2/3
STRG + K STRG + ←/→⌘ + K ⌘ + ←/→

3. Integriertes Terminal umschalten

Windows/LinuxMac OS
STRG + `⌘ + `

Das integrierte Terminal in VS Code ist eine sehr praktische Funktion, mit der Sie die Aufgabe schnell ausführen können, ohne das Fenster zu wechseln. Um das Terminal im Editor ein- und auszublenden, ist diese Tastenkombination sehr praktisch.

Integriertes Terminal

Wenn Sie jedoch, wie ich, das Drücken von “STRG+” aufgrund der seltsamen Eckposition als schwierig empfinden, können Sie die Befehlspalette trotzdem öffnen und ausführen View: Toggle Terminal Befehl.

Terminal mit Befehlspalette umschalten

4. Gehe zu Datei

Windows/LinuxMac OS
STRG + P+ P

Wenn das Projekt wächst, kann die Suche nach einer Datei zu einer sehr schwierigen Aufgabe werden. Daher würde ich vorschlagen, dass sogar Sie eine Maus verwenden, dieser Befehl kann Ihnen viel Zeit beim Suchen und Navigieren zu einer Datei in einem Repository sparen.

Gehe zu Datei

5. Gehe zu Zeile

Windows/LinuxMac OS
STRG + G^ + G

Nachdem Sie eine Datei durchsucht haben, möchten Sie möglicherweise zu einer bestimmten Zeile springen, um Code hinzuzufügen oder zu bearbeiten. Wenn eine Datei Tausende von Codezeilen enthält, kann das Scrollen definitiv Ihre Zeit verschlingen. Daher können Sie mit STRG+G oder ^+G VS Code-Tastaturkürzel schnell zu einer gewünschten Zeile gelangen.

Gehe zur Zeile

Alternativ können Sie auch die vierte Verknüpfung für “Gehe zu Datei” verwenden, an der angehängt wird : Doppelpunkt mit Zeilennummer im Eingabefeld funktioniert als ‘Gehe zu Zeile’.

6. Komplettes Projekt suchen

Windows/LinuxMac OS
STRG + UMSCHALT + F⌘ + UMSCHALT + F

Höchstwahrscheinlich möchten Sie auch in Ihrem gesamten Projekt nach einem Text, einer Variablen oder einer Funktion suchen. In einem solchen Fall ist dieser Befehl sehr praktisch, der die Sucheingabe in der Seitenleiste anzeigt.

Projekt suchen

Sie können Ihrer Suche auch Filter hinzufügen, indem Sie ALT+C verwenden, um die Groß-/Kleinschreibung abzugleichen, ALT+W, um das ganze Wort zu finden, und ALT+R, um einen regulären Ausdruck zu verwenden.

7. Zen-Modus

Windows/LinuxMac OS
STRG + KZ+ KZ

Möchten Sie in einer ablenkungsfreien Umgebung arbeiten, um konzentrierter zu bleiben? Der Zen-Modus ist eine Funktion in einem VS-Code, die die gesamte Benutzeroberfläche (Statusleiste, Aktivitätsleiste, Bedienfeld und Seitenleiste) ausblendet und nur den Editor im Vollbildmodus anzeigt.

Zen-Modus

Um den Zen-Modus zu aktivieren, können Sie entweder die obige Verknüpfung verwenden oder die Befehlspalette öffnen und “Ansicht: Zen-Modus umschalten” ausführen. Um den Zen-Modus zu verlassen, müssen Sie drücken Esc zweimal drücken.

8. Auswahl zum nächsten Suchtreffer hinzufügen

Windows/LinuxMac OS
STRG + D+ D

Mit diesem Befehl können Sie das nächste Vorkommen eines ausgewählten Textes zum Bearbeiten auswählen. Es ist sehr praktisch, wenn das nächste Spiel weit weg vom ersten Spiel liegt.

Nächste Übereinstimmung finden

9. Zeilenkommentar umschalten

Windows/LinuxMac OS
STRG + /+ /

Der Kampf, den Anfang einer Zeile zu erreichen und dann der Kommentarzeile einen doppelten Schrägstrich hinzuzufügen, kann mit dieser schnellen Tastenkombination ersetzt werden.

Code auskommentieren

Auch wenn Sie mehrere Zeilen auskommentieren möchten, können Sie mit alle Zeilen auswählen SHIFT+UP/Down und drücke dann CTRL+/.

10. Zum Anfang oder Ende der Datei springen

Windows/LinuxMac OS
STRG + HOME/ENDE⌘ + ↑/↓

Wenn Sie sich mitten in Ihren Codes verirren, kann der Befehl helfen, schnell entweder den Anfang oder das Ende der Datei zu erreichen.

11. Code-Falten oder -Entfalten

Windows/LinuxMac OS
STRG + UMSCHALT + [ or ]+ ⌘ + [ or ]

Es ist eine der nützlichsten Tastenkombinationen, die Ihnen helfen kann, einen Codebereich zu reduzieren/aufzuklappen. Auf diese Weise können Sie unnötigen Code ausblenden und jeweils nur den erforderlichen Codeabschnitt anzeigen, um sich besser zu konzentrieren und schneller zu programmieren.

Reduzieren Sie eine Coderegion

12. Peek-Implementierung

Windows/LinuxMac OS
STRG + UMSCHALT + F12⌘ + UMSCHALT + F12

Die Verknüpfung wird Ihnen höchstwahrscheinlich bei Ihrer Codeanalyse oder Fehlerbehebung helfen, wenn Sie die Funktionsweise von Funktionen und Variablen verstehen möchten.

Peek-Implementierung

13. Aktuelle Zeile löschen

Windows/LinuxMac OS
STRG + UMSCHALT + KUMSCHALT + ⌘ + K

Ein einzelner Schnellbefehl kann zwei Aufgaben zusammenfassen, nämlich die Auswahl einer aktuellen Zeile und das Drücken der Lösch-/Rücktaste.

14. Suchen und ersetzen

Windows/LinuxMac OS
STRG + F
STRG + H
+ F
⌥ + ⌘ + F

Was könnte der beste Weg sein, um alle Vorkommen eines Textes in einer Datei durch einen neuen zu ersetzen? Wenn Sie nacheinander manuell durch den Code scrollen, ist es kein Wunder, wie lange es dauert, wenn der Text groß ist.

Suchen und Ersetzen

Während Sie Suchen und Ersetzen verwenden, führen Sie dieselbe Aufgabe innerhalb von Sekunden aus. Sie können es mit zwei Tastenkombinationen öffnen, wobei eine das Eingabefeld zum Suchen von Text und die andere zum Ersetzen von Text öffnet.

15. VS Code-Tastaturkürzel

Windows/LinuxMac OS
STRG + K STRG + S+ K ⌘ + S

Wenn Sie immer noch Schwierigkeiten haben, sich alle oben genannten Tastenkombinationen zu merken, müssen Sie sich keine Sorgen machen. Dies liegt daran, dass Sie mit der obigen Verknüpfung alle verfügbaren Befehle für Ihren Editor anzeigen können.

Tastatürkürzel

Hier können Sie auch die Tastenbelegung für den Befehl nach Belieben bearbeiten.

Möchten Sie mehr Tastaturkürzel für VS Code?

Wenn Sie vollständige Kenntnisse über die Tastenkombinationen von VS Code haben möchten, können Sie die Dokumentation von Visual Studio-Code.

Oder, wenn Sie alle verfügbaren Verknüpfungen auf einem einzigen Blatt Papier haben möchten, holen Sie sich den Spickzettel für Linux, Mac OS, und Fenster. Sie können schnell nachsehen, wenn Sie es vergessen.